City of Kawartha Lakes OPP – Driver Facing Numerous Charges

In Police Blotter

(CITY OF KAWARTHA LAKES, ON) – On Friday June 26, 2020 at approximately 3:20 pm an officer from the City of Kawartha Lakes (CKL) detachment of the Ontario Provincial Police (OPP) was patrolling Sturgeon Road in the area of King’s Wharf Road.

At this time a vehicle was observed travelling well in excess of the posted 80 km/h. The officer initiated a traffic stop however the driver failed to stop and continued along King’s Wharf Road and abandoned the vehicle in a nearby field.

The driver, 55 year old Roger Roadhouse of Lindsay, was located with the assistance of the OPP’s Canine Unit a short time later and arrested and charged with the following offences:
Dangerous Operation contrary to the Criminal Code of Canada (CCC)

Flight From Police contrary to the CCC

Race a Motor Vehicle – Excessive Speed contrary to the Highway Traffic Act (HTA)

Drive Motor Vehicle No Currently Validated Permit contrary to the HTA

Use Plate Not Authorized for Vehicle contrary to the HTA

Operate a Motor Vehicle Without Insurance contrary to the Compulsory Automobile Insurance Act

The accused is scheduled to appear in the Ontario Court of Justice in Lindsay on September 10, 2020.
